Yskäkohtaukset
Yskäkohtaukset refers to episodes of coughing. Coughing is a vital reflex mechanism of the respiratory system designed to clear the airways of irritants, mucus, or foreign particles. These episodes can vary significantly in intensity, duration, and frequency, depending on the underlying cause.
Common triggers for yskäkohtaukset include respiratory infections such as the common cold, influenza, bronchitis, and pneumonia.
